What's The Definition Of Charisma?
charisma
uncountable noun: You say that someone has charisma when they can attract, influence, and inspire people by their personal qualities. charisma in American English a divinely inspired gift, grace, or talent, as for prophesying, healing, etc. noun: a divinely conferred gift or power charisma in British English noun: a special personal quality or power of an individual making him or her capable of influencing or inspiring large numbers of people |
